UGR-Rated Emergency Panel Lights

UGR (Unified Glare Rating) is a standard used to measure the potential for glare in lighting systems. UGR-rated emergency panel lights are designed to provide a comfortable and non-glaring lighting environment, especially in areas where glare can be a concern, such as offices, schools, and hospitals. These lights are engineered to minimize glare and ensure optimal visibility without causing discomfort to the users.

LED Emergency Panel Lights for Cleanrooms

Cleanrooms are controlled environments used in various industries, including pharmaceuticals, electronics, and biotechnology. LED emergency panel lights for cleanrooms are designed to meet the strict cleanliness and safety requirements of these environments. These lights are engineered to minimize dust and particle generation, ensuring a clean and safe working environment.

Features of LED Emergency Panel Lights for Cleanrooms

  • Low Particle Emission: The design of these lights minimizes the generation of dust and particles, maintaining the cleanliness of the cleanroom.
  • High IP Rating: These lights are designed with high IP ratings, ensuring resistance to dust, moisture, and other environmental factors.
  • Uniform Illumination: The even distribution of light ensures optimal visibility without causing glare or shadows.
